After a 5 year hiatus from the Toronto 48 Hour Film contest 416film has returned, more… than they ever returned before! The film screened at Innis Town Hall theatre on Nov. 18, 2024. We will update when we are able to show the film for all to check out on our youtube channel but for now…ta-dah! The Whizz Dicks Film Poster!
Whizz Dicks – 48 Hour Film Poster